1. Monocrystalline Solar Panels
Monocrystalline solar panels are made from a single crystal of silicon. They are the most efficient type of solar panel available, with an efficiency rating of up to 22%. This means that they can convert up to 22% of the sun’s energy into electricity. Monocrystalline solar panels are also the most expensive type of solar panel, but they are popular because of their high efficiency.
2. Polycrystalline Solar Panels
Polycrystalline solar panels are made from multiple crystals of silicon. They are slightly less efficient than monocrystalline solar panels, with an efficiency rating of up to 18%. However, they are also less expensive than monocrystalline solar panels, making them a popular choice for homeowners and businesses.
3. Thin-Film Solar Panels
Thin-film solar panels are made from a thin layer of photovoltaic material, such as amorphous silicon, cadmium telluride, or copper indium gallium selenide. They are less efficient than monocrystalline and polycrystalline solar panels, with an efficiency rating of up to 12%. However, they are also less expensive than other types of solar panels, and they can be flexible and lightweight, making them a popular choice for portable solar panels.
4. BIPV Solar Panels
BIPV (Building-Integrated Photovoltaic) solar panels are designed to be integrated into the building’s architecture. They can be used as roofing materials, windows, or facades, and they are designed to be aesthetically pleasing. BIPV solar panels are typically made from thin-film technology, and they are less efficient than other types of solar panels. However, they can provide a dual function of both generating electricity and serving as a building material.
5. Hybrid Solar Panels
Hybrid solar panels combine two or more types of solar cells to increase efficiency and performance. For example, a hybrid solar panel may combine monocrystalline and thin-film solar cells to create a more efficient solar panel. Hybrid solar panels are typically more expensive than other types of solar panels, but they can also provide a higher return on investment over time.
